<p><a href="http://onelove.com.au/wp/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/TonsOfFriends_500.jpg" rel="lightbox[348]"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-349" style="margin-right: 10px;" title="TonsOfFriends_500" src="http://onelove.com.au/wp/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/TonsOfFriends_500-300x300.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="300" /></a>The hot fuss surrounding Crookers is about to reach fever pitch. Already the hippest act in dance circles they will soon unleash their debut album on the world and things are expected to go mad for the two men from Milan. Their remix of Kid Cudi’s Day ‘n’ Night reached number two in the UK earlier this year and is now riding high on the US Airplay charts. This, and their already huge body of work, has attracted the attention of Kanye West and Will I Am  who have become fans and collaborators. Dolce &amp; Gabbana recently used their U2 remix for the catwalk and their MySpace page is getting more traffic than Coldplay. Like we said, Crookers are about to go boom!</p>
<p>After remixing such huge names in pop and rock Crookers have now gone direct to some of their favourite artists to work alongside on their debut album. Aptly titled Tons Of Friends the roll call of pals involved is jaw dropping. It includes, Kelis, Soulwax,Major lazer, RadioClit, Spank Rock, Pitbull, Tim Burgess, Kardinal official and Roisin Murphy. The tracks have been worked on in various studios around Europe or ideas have been developed through i-chat and e-mail. “Will I am was great to work with, he&#8217;s constantly searching for new sounds. He was full of energy in the studio, bouncing ideas around all the time.” &#8220;Roisin was amazing, she wrote to a beat in the studio and recorded her song in one day. So did Spank Rock, just heard the beat and then wrote and recorded that same night&#8221;</p>
<p>In Ibiza last year they met Chas Smash of Madness, an unlikely alliance seeing as the group are so quintessentially English.  “When we realised he was ‘the heavy, heavy monster sound’ guy, we wanted to work on an updated version of this track we loved (One Step Beyond).” Also expect feisty performances from Kelis and Roisin Murphy, “Kelis is about making the party blow up and Roisin is singing about not being taken for a sucker.” There’s also a collaboration between the daddies of this scene as Crookers hook up with Diplo and Switch for a track called Jump Up. All ears will be on that one from the three heavyweight pioneers of bastard basslines.</p>
<p>So watch out this summer as Crookers retain their status as dons of the dancefloor but further their audience with their mutant take on R&amp;B and pop. They already have tons of friends but by the end of the year they’ll have a whole load more.</p>

<div id="_mcePaste">Booka Shade will release their fourth artist album More! this May in a joint venture between Get Physical Music and Co-Op.</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">“The album is called More!. More refined production, more multi-layered atmospheres, more emotion.” Explains Arno Kammermeier. “We wanted this album to be more energetic with strong grooves and of course the typical Booka Shade melodies and atmospheres that we love. The album takes you through every stage of the night out; the excitement before you go out, the party, the late, late night, a bit of paranoia&#8230;. and then the sunny morning of a new day.”</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">Across the album, Arno and Walter Merziger delve deeper than ever before, delivering what has to be their most dynamic and accomplished album to date, which is saying something for Booka Shade! For the first time on any of their albums they’ve collaborated with guest vocalists, sharing the limelight with electronic pioneers Yello and Get Physical favourite Chelonis R. Jones.</div>
<blockquote>
<div id="_mcePaste">“We’re so excited about 2010 and taking the new album on the road. We’ve been working on these songs in the studio for the last 18 months and now is the time to hear them loud!” Arno continues, “The world tour will start in February with us headlining the Future Music Festival in Australia, followed by club shows in key cities throughout Europe and a short trip to the U.S. to introduce the album Stateside. I can safely say we have a big summer of festivals in front of us too!”.</div>
</blockquote>
<div id="_mcePaste">Indeed they do, with the full live schedule to be announced very soon, including (for the first time ever) a fully live UK tour, taking in all the major cities across the country (see below for a preview of confirmed dates). Until then, please log on to Booka Shade&#8217;s website to download Regenerate, one of the stand-out tracks from the album that will not only delight fans but also give the world a clear sign of what&#8217;s to come with More!</div>

<p><strong>What&#8217;s it all about?</strong></p>
<p><strong> <span style="font-weight: normal;">This is the debut album from much hyped Italian house producer, Stefano Miele, AKA Riva Starr. After a string of attention-grabbing releases and remixes for the likes of Fatboy Slim and the Gossip, 2010 is poised to be the year Riva Starr really makes his name.</span></strong></p>
<p><strong>As an example&#8230;<br />
<span style="font-weight: normal;">&#8220;Yesterday I was drunk, with some chicks in the club/I don&#8217;t remember who came back with me/And tonight I will drink, with some chicks in the club, I&#8217;m not sure I want to, ooh la la la.&#8221;</span></strong></p>
<p><strong>So is it any good?<br />
<span style="font-weight: normal;">Riva Starr is seriously hot property right now, snapped up by Jesse Rose&#8217;s Made to Play label &#8211; after previous releases on Claude VonStroke&#8217;s Dirty Bird imprint and Fatboy Slim&#8217;s Southern Fried &#8211; he has a six-month waiting list for club appearances and was the talk of the blogosphere last year.</span></strong></p>
<p>The amusingly-titled If Life Gives You Lemons, Make Lemonade is based around of his chunky, Balkan/Mezcla house sound, and is full of the macho Italian swagger you would expect from someone on such a sharp career trajectory; typified by the Noze co-produced lead single I Was Drunk (lyrics above).</p>
<p>Maybe it has something to do with his ten-year career producing under different guises, or his talent for remixing other people&#8217;s work, but the one thing that becomes very clear listening to this album is that he&#8217;s not very original. The album is littered with fairly explicit references to his influences: from becoming the ninth producer to pillage the classic horn sample on Lafayette Afro Rock Band&#8217;s Darkest Night in his homage to 80s electro, Black Mama, to the verbatim use of Ramiez&#8217;s Hablando riff on Caballeros, or the re-interpretation of Mr Fingers Chicago house masterpiece, Can You Feel It, for Tribute. The trouble is, like any good parody, he clearly has a deep devotion to the subject matter, and as a result many of the rip-offs sound better than the originals.</p>
<p>Apparently he calls this mimicking style &#8217;snatch&#8217; – also the name of his forthcoming record label &#8211; with the album supposed to represent the variety of his musical taste and DJ sets. So whilst he may be something of a musical impersonator, he has managed to successfully combine the best elements of catchy commercial dance with the production detail and depth of more respected underground producers. And in doing so he has created a varied collection of club tools that puts him right up amongst the best of his peers..</p>

<p>The Totem Onelove Group welcomes the iconic international music festival: Creamfields to Australia for the first time. Creamfields has already toured every continent and brings an all star cast to Australia in May this year.</p>
<p>Creamfields has established itself as the worlds greatest electronic music festival. Now in its 12th year it continues to dominate the festival market, spanning 17 countries and attracting a worldwide audience of nearly 3 million people. Beginning life in Winchester (UK) in 1998, Creamfields continues to hold the crown as one of the worlds favorite dance festival brands.</p>

<div id="_mcePaste">Just to be clear: The Bloody Beetroots are a duo when they play live, but it’s actually one person who makes the music. And that person is Bob Rifo, also credited as Sir Bob Cornelius Rifo. But that’s not his only alias. As Bobermann he makes remixes for other dj’s that are different from the ones he makes for The Bloody Beetroots.</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">This story starts in 2006. The Belgian electroband Goose release their album ‘Bring it on’. It was their first album and it was an important one. They had to prove something, as they won the Humo’s Rock Rally, one of Belgium most important music competitions, in 2002. ‘Bring it on’ was a Belgian chart success, followed by a performance on Rock Werchter 2007. Although all tracks were brilliant, they begged for a remix. The Bloody Beetroots remixed two tracks of them. The instrumental track ‘Black Gloves’, which has vocals on the remix and ‘Everybody’. Both tracks can be found on the album ‘Bring It On (Rarities and Remixes)’, available on iTunes.</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">And then there was Sound of Stereo. The Belgian dj-duo emerged in 2009, with gigs all over the world. Their EP ‘Heads Up’ became a big success and featured remixes from Mightyfools and others. But the biggest remix was the one from The Bloody Beetroots. ‘Heads Up (The Bloody Beetroots Remix) was featured on Solid Sounds 2009 – Volume 1, one of Belgians most important dance compilations. Sound of Stereo is a duo, consisting of Jochen Sablon and Vincent De Boeck. According to their Facebook fanpage, they play Fidget, House, Crunk and Dubstep. That same Jochen Sablon is an important contributor to ‘Romborama’. He co-wrote ‘Better DJ on 2 Turntables’, the 6th track on the album, alongside Bob Rifo himself.</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">Bob Rifo has more than one alias. As Bobermann he remixed ‘Death Suite’, the result of an anticipated collaboration between Erol Alkan and Boys Noize. That remix could be downloaded for free from different websites. Later on Bobermann remixed the track ‘Drummer’ by Boys Noize. Recently Bobermann presented his newest remix ‘Mitsubitchi’, a track by another Belgian electroband The Subs. A remix he was very proud since he posted it on his website, www.deathcrew77.com. Yes, here are the Belgians again. The Subs, originating from Ghent, released their first album in 2008. The singles ‘Kiss My Trance’ and ‘Music Is The New Religion’ were a chart success, although their music videos might have something to do with that. NME gave them a 8 out of 10 rating, pretty high for a relatively unknown Belgian band.</div>
<div id="_mcePaste">The Bloody Beetroots already played a lot of important Belgian dance events. They played the influential Pukkelpop festival two times in a row, in 2008 and 2009. The dancehall was packed in 2009, the crowd went crazy. It was a much talked about gig afterwards. Belgium is famous for the ‘I Love Techno’ festival, taking place in November. The Bloody Beetroots played a dj-set in 2008 and 2009. At that time, the music video for ‘Warp 1.9’ was played on high rotation on the popular radio and television stations. ‘Woop Woop’ became a common shout-out at parties.</div>

Just signed! Swiss dynamic duo Round Table Knights’ Calypso EP, It’s out 15th February on Jesse Rose’s Made to Play Label and out on Onelove Recordings in Australia.</p>
<p>The Round Table Knights are a Swiss DJ / Producer duo consisting of DJ Questionmark and DJ Atomik. It‘s been a ten year journey from the Swiss province to the high plateaus of contemporary dance music where they have recently pitched their tents in the camp of  Jesse Rose’s ‚ Made To Play‘</p>
<p>If you had to chose one single word to characterise them it could only be diversity. The RTK play all kinds of Electronic/ Accoustic/ Futuristic/ Exciting/ Romantic/ Intense music. Their musical horizon kept them behind the decks in clubs and at festivals all over Europe. “It’s all about the mix” they say.</p>
